Ingredients:

  • 2 cups graham cracker crumbs
  • 1/2 cup melted butter
  • 16 oz cream cheese, softened
  • 1/2 cup sugar
  • 2 eggs
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1/2 cup strawberry jam
  • 1/4 cup white chocolate chips

Method:

Step 1: Preheat Your Oven

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C). This simple yet crucial step ensures your cheesecake bars cook evenly and come out just right.

Step 2: Prepare the Crust

In a mixing bowl, combine 2 cups of graham cracker crumbs and 1/2 cup of melted butter. Mix until the crumbs are evenly moistened. Press this mixture firmly into a lined baking pan, making sure you cover the bottom evenly. This will be the delicious base of your bars!

Step 3: Make the Creamy Filling

In another bowl, beat 16 oz of softened cream cheese with 1/2 cup of sugar until smooth and creamy. Add in 2 eggs and 1 tsp of vanilla extract, mixing well until everything is combined and fluffy. Pour this luscious filling over your graham cracker crust.

Step 4: Add the Jam and Bake

Drop spoonfuls of 1/2 cup strawberry jam on top of the cheesecake filling. Use a knife to gently swirl the jam into the cream cheese mixture for that lovely marbled effect. Bake for 25-30 minutes or until set. Once baked, let your bars cool completely.

Finish by melting 1/4 cup of white chocolate chips and drizzling it over the cool cheesecake bars. Chill, slice, and serve!

Storage & Leftovers Guide

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ator, where they’ll stay fresh for up to 5 days. Alternatively, you can freeze them for longer storage. Simply wrap individual bars tightly and store in a freezer-safe container for up to 3 months. Thaw them in the fridge overnight before serving!

Kitchen Wisdom & Success Tips

  • Make sure your cream cheese is softened to room temperature for the smoothest filling.
  • Use a toothpick or skewer to achieve the perfect swirl with the jam—don’t be afraid to get artistic!
  • Test for doneness by gently shaking the pan; the filling should be slightly jiggly but not liquid.

Flavor Variations & Adaptations

While strawberry jam is delightful, feel free to substitute it with raspberry, blueberry, or even a mix of your favorite preserves! For a more adventurous twist, add citrus zest or a splash of lemon juice to the filling for a tangy kick.

Reader Questions & Solutions

  1. Q: My cheesecake bars cracked while baking. What did I do wrong?
    A: Cracking often occurs due to rapid temperature shifts. Try baking at a lower temperature next time or leaving the oven door slightly ajar for the last few minutes to prevent sudden temperature changes.

  2. Q: Can I use low-fat cream cheese?
    A: Yes, you can use low-fat cream cheese. Just keep in mind that the bars may be slightly less creamy and rich.

  3. Q: What if I don’t have graham crackers?
    A: You can substitute them with digestive biscuits, vanilla wafers, or crushed cookies. Just make sure they’re finely ground and mix them with an equal amount of melted butter.

  4. Q: Can I make these bars ahead of time?
    A: Absolutely! They taste even better after chilling in the fridge overnight, allowing the flavors to meld perfectly.

  5. Q: How do I know when the cheesecake bars are done?
    A: The edges should be set, while the center will have a slight jiggle when shaken. They’ll firm up as they cool.
